I was assigned to 2d Recon out in Lejeune. I was an open-contract supply guy, and I totally hated my MOS, so I went to work for my Company 1stSgt and CO, then went on to be in the color guard, which was pretty kick ***. Then I got to go to Iraq and be in the BN CO's PSD (Personal Security Detail) and be a VC/MK-19 gunner.
Anyhow, a few of my friends tried out for RIP, and from what they said, and the way they hobbled around the barracks in the evenings, it sounded pretty hardcore. For every guy that makes it through RIP, they drop about ten. Swimming and all-day thrash-sessions are gonna be daily routines for him. This dude ought to have his work cut out for him.
